モバイル アプリ開発の文脈におけるジェスチャー認識とは、スマートフォンやタブレットのタッチスクリーンなどのタッチ センシティブな入力面上でユーザーが行う特定の手や指の動きをソフトウェア アプリケーションが識別、解釈し、応答するプロセスを指します。 2007 年に初代 iPhone が発表されて以来、このテクノロジーはモバイル デバイスにとって重要性を増しており、これにより家庭用電化製品にマルチタッチ インターフェイスが普及しました。
ジェスチャ認識の基礎となる原理には、タッチ イベントをキャプチャして処理し、数学的計算を実行してユーザーの入力が認識可能なアクションを構成するかどうかを判断する機能が含まれます。開発者は、機械学習、コンピューター ビジョン、その他の補助テクノロジーを利用して、異なるジェスチャを区別しながら、誤ったまたは不正確な識別の可能性を最小限に抑えます。その結果、検出されたジェスチャを使用して、アプリケーションのさまざまな側面を制御したり、特定の機能をトリガーしたりできます。
ジェスチャ認識には、主にオンラインとオフラインの 2 つのタイプがあります。オンライン ジェスチャ認識には、ジェスチャのリアルタイム処理と解釈が含まれ、ユーザーがアプリケーションを瞬時に操作できるようになります。このタイプは、対話性と応答性の向上を促進するため、モバイル アプリ開発で広く使用されています。対照的に、オフライン認識では、ジェスチャ データがキャプチャされた後に処理されるため、より詳細な分析が可能になりますが、オンライン認識システムによって提供される即時のフィードバックはありません。
Technavio が実施した調査によると、世界のジェスチャ認識市場は、2017 年から 2021 年の間に 27.54% の年間複合成長率 (CAGR) で成長すると予想されています。この成長は、より多くの機能を提供するために、モバイル アプリ開発におけるジェスチャ認識の関連性と採用の増加を裏付けています。自然で直感的、没入型のユーザー エクスペリエンス。
モバイル アプリケーション開発のコンテキストでは、iOS や Android などの一般的なプラットフォームは、スワイプ、タップ、ピンチ、回転などの事前定義された一連のジェスチャを提供する組み込みのジェスチャ認識フレームワークを提供します。これらのジェスチャはアプリケーションに簡単に組み込むことができ、大規模なカスタム ジェスチャ認識ロジックを実装することなく、シームレスな対話を促進します。ただし、開発者は、事前定義されたフレームワークや標準ジェスチャが特定の要件に対して不十分な場合でも、カスタム ソリューションを活用できます。
AppMasterでは、 no-codeプラットフォームを使用して、標準化されたジェスチャ フレームワークをシームレスに統合することで、お客様がプロ グレードのジェスチャ認識機能を備えた高品質のモバイル アプリケーションを作成できるようにします。この統合により、顧客はジェスチャ認識アルゴリズムや実装の詳細を詳しく調べる必要がなくなり、ジェスチャ対応モバイル アプリケーションの開発と保守に必要な時間と労力が節約されます。
AppMaster 、主要なno-codeアプリ開発プラットフォームとして、ジェスチャー認識などの最先端のテクノロジーを含む、現代のモバイル アプリ エコシステムの増大する需要と複雑さに対応できるように設計されています。ユーザーは、ドラッグ アンド ドロップ機能を使用してインタラクティブなモバイル アプリケーション UI を作成し、Mobile BP デザイナーで各コンポーネントのビジネス ロジックを定義できます。AppMaster AppMasterソース コードの自動生成、コンパイル、テスト、およびデプロイメントを処理します。
さらに、当社のプラットフォームのサーバー主導型アプローチにより、お客様は新しいバージョンを App Store や Play Market に送信することなく、モバイル アプリケーションの UI、ロジック、API キーを更新できます。この柔軟なシステムにより、 AppMasterを使用して構築されたアプリケーションは、ユーザー エクスペリエンス、セキュリティ、パフォーマンスに妥協することなく、ジェスチャ認識などの高度な機能を組み込んで、進化し続ける技術情勢の先を行くことができます。
要約すると、ジェスチャ認識はモバイル アプリ開発の重要な側面であり、さまざまな指や手のジェスチャの識別と解釈を通じて、タッチ センシティブ デバイス上で自然かつ直感的なユーザー インタラクションを可能にします。このテクノロジーの普及に伴い、 AppMasterなどのモバイル アプリ開発プラットフォームにはジェスチャー認識機能が組み込まれ、ジェスチャー対応アプリケーションの作成を検討している顧客にシームレスで効率的な開発プロセスを提供しています。